|
自定义了PS1后,发现长命令行编辑时很奇怪的现象,删除一个字符它就往上跳一行,这到底是怎么回事?
[HTML][23:06:22 ~]$ (a=/usr/share/doc/bash/NEWS; expr $a : '.*/\(.*\)' \| $a)
[23:06:22 ~]$ (a=/usr/share/doc/bash-/NEWS; expr $a : '.*/\(.*\)' \| $a)
[23:06:22 ~]$ (a=/usr/share/doc/bash-3/NEWS; expr $a : '.*/\(.*\)' \| $a)
[23:06:22 ~]$ (a=/usr/share/doc/bash-3./NEWS; expr $a : '.*/\(.*\)' \| $a)
| $a)[/HTML]
[HTML]export PS1='[\e[32m\t\e[0m \W]\\$ '[/HTML] |
|